Most facilities still treat their P&IDs as static reference files — printed, scanned, and disconnected from the systems that run the plant. The Intelligent Drawing Platform converts AutoCAD drawings into fully intelligent documents in seconds: every tag, line, and instrument becomes structured data with automatic asset identification, inter-drawing navigation, and off-page connector linking.
This product overview covers the core toolset — the search tool for work planning, asset inventory classification for Master Equipment Lists, group highlighting for piping circuits and HAZOP nodes, process mapping for complete line lists, hierarchy creation for CMMS implementations, and electronic redlining that keeps drafting in sync with the field.
It also walks the platform across the asset lifecycle, from commissioning walkdowns to decommissioning boundaries.
